What is Theta Fuel?

 

Theta Fuel is one of the two native tokens on the Theta blockchain and should not be mistaken for Theta Token (THETA). Theta Fuel (TFUEL) is the utility token in the delivery of decentralised video and data that also acts as a Gas token.

 

Key Features and Takeaways of Theta Fuel

 

Theta Fuel (TFUEL) is one of the most popular cryptocurrencies in the crypto space that has the following key features and takeaways:

Mitch Liu and Jieyi Long co-founded Theta Fuel and the entire Theta Ecosystem in 2017.

Liu has extensive experience in gaming, video, and virtual reality (VR) industries and was involved in co-founding Tapjoy, Gameview Studios, and THETA.tv, which is the live streaming platform that was the first decentralised application (DApp) to be built on the Theta protocol.

Long, the second founder and CTO, has experience in design automation, gaming, VR, and large-scale distribution system. He has also authored many peer-reviewed academic papers and he holds several patents in video streaming, blockchain, and VR.

The main use case for Theta is its decentralised video streaming, data delivery, and edge computing which benefits the protocol by making it efficient, cost-effective, and fair for all industry participants.

The Theta network runs on its own native blockchain and has two native tokens, Theta (THETA), and Theta Fuel (TFUEL), which powers the internal economy.

The appeal that Theta has involves the benefits that viewers, content creators, and middlemen get from using the protocol and network.

Users of Theta are incentivised to watch network content and to share various resources, with their rewards in the form of TFUEL tokens.

Theta is open-source and token holders have governance power.

Theta runs on a Proof of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, making staking possible. The amount of THETA that is in circulation is the maximum cap and users are rewarded in TFUEL for staking on the network.

In addition to the PoS, Theta also uses a multi-level Byzantine Fault Tolerance (BFT) consensus mechanism to achieve additional security with a higher transaction throughput.

With the launch of mainnet in 2019, Theta also introduced Guardian Nodes. With these nodes, there is no single entity that can control most of the THETA tokens that are staked at any one time. This helps the Theta network achieve a higher transaction throughput of more than 1 000 transaction per second (TPS).

tv is a video streaming site, like Twitch. However, instead of streaming data from Content Delivery Networks (CDNs), it is shared by the peers that watch the video stream. While users watch these streams, and subsequently share it, they are given TFUEL, which can be used to pay gas fees.

Theta also uses an Aggregated Signature Gossip Scheme, which allows Guardian Nodes to keep combining partially aggregated signatures from neighbours, followed by the gossiping of the aggregated signature.

Resource Orientated Micro-payment Pool is an off-chain payment pool used by Theta, allowing users to create an off-chain payment pool from which other users can withdraw using transactions that are off-chain.

Another feature that keeps Theta fast and efficient, is that there are 10 to 20 validator nodes and more than a thousand Guardian Nodes. Guardian Nodes could take exceptionally long to reach consensus and thus, to keep them compliant with the Validator Committee, they need only agree on the hash of the checkpoint blocks.

 

 

Theta Fuel Mining

 

TFUEL is the second native token in the Theta network, and it works alongside the THETA token. TFUEL cannot be mined as it is the operational token of the Theta Protocol. TFUEL works to power on-chain operations such as payments to Relayers when they share a video stream or when they deploy or interact with smart contracts.

For every video that they share, Relayers earn TFUEL and for this reason, it can be seen as the “gas” of the protocol. TFUEL was created when mainnet launched in 2019 and it is an ERC20 token. Users who want to start earning TFUEL can access THETA.tv or SLIVER.tv.

On these platforms, users can earn TFUEL for each minute that the user watches streams on the platform. As the user watches these streams, Theta accesses the upload bandwidth of the user to share the stream with other viewers and the more the user shares, the more TFUEL they can earn.

Users can have a maximum of 10 peers viewing from the stream that they share, and users must note that their bandwidth will affect their TFUEL earning rate. TFUEL is credited to the user after 10 minutes following the data shared to the user’s peers and opening additional internet tabs will not earn the user any TFUEL.

Should you buy Theta Fuel?

 

Investment in Theta Fuel is dependent in the interest that investors have in the Theta platform, along with how many users actively participate in the viewing and sharing of streams. The Theta platform has a lot of points that have drawn in more investors, especially over the past few months.

The Theta protocol is fully decentralised and provides video streaming services that are open-sourced. With an increase in video content creation and people becoming interested in streaming services, Theta has a bright future ahead of it, if it ensures that content featured is relative and that targeted audiences are reached.
